Output 72598cd99e0248253390dda97105eedf8b5783176e4919e0e2521f2ee5702425:1

value
4204213
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2a8a4ed88904d9c3e99931caa8b2eca315e9c67b OP_EQUALVERIFY OP_CHECKSIG
address
14sw4s9XPXWu1snnStc8UBiy8j9q1ZEaR6
transaction
72598cd99e0248253390dda97105eedf8b5783176e4919e0e2521f2ee5702425
spent
true